One of the primary advantages of fluorescent tube lighting is its energy efficiency Compared to traditional incandescent bulbs, fluorescent tubes consume significantly less energy while producing the same amount of light This makes them an attractive option for businesses looking to reduce their energy costs and environmental impact In addition, fluorescent tubes have a longer lifespan than incandescent bulbs, further increasing their cost-effectiveness.
Over the years, advancements in technology have led to improvements in fluorescent tube design and performance One significant development was the introduction of electronic ballasts, which replaced the traditional magnetic ballasts used to regulate the flow of electricity to the lamp Electronic ballasts offer several benefits, including improved energy efficiency, reduced flickering, and quieter operation.

In recent years, LED technology has emerged as a formidable competitor to fluorescent lighting LED bulbs are even more energy-efficient than fluorescent tubes and have a longer lifespan While LEDs were initially more expensive than fluorescent lighting, advancements in manufacturing have led to a significant decrease in price, making them a more viable option for many consumers.
Despite the rise of LED lighting, fluorescent tubes still have a strong presence in the market Their affordability, reliability, and bright illumination make them a preferred choice for many businesses and homeowners Fluorescent tubes are commonly used in large indoor spaces such as offices, schools, hospitals, and warehouses where consistent, bright lighting is essential.
